Landscape mulching services involve the application of mulch material around plants, trees, and garden beds to enhance the appearance of a property while providing practical benefits. These services typically include preparing the area, selecting appropriate mulch types such as wood chips, bark, or compost, and evenly spreading the material to create a uniform look. Professional contractors can tailor the mulching process to suit different landscape designs, ensuring that the mulch not only protects plant roots but also complements the overall aesthetic of the yard.

Mulching addresses several common property problems, including weed growth, soil erosion, and moisture retention. By covering the soil with mulch, homeowners can significantly reduce weed intrusion, minimizing the need for frequent weeding and chemical treatments. Mulch also helps prevent soil erosion caused by heavy rains or wind, especially on slopes or uneven terrain. Additionally, it acts as a natural insulator, maintaining consistent soil moisture levels, which is beneficial during hot or dry periods, supporting healthier plant growth and reducing water consumption.

The overview below groups typical Landscape Mulching proj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Myrtle Beach, SC.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Basic Mulching - Many local contractors charge between $250 and $600 for standard mulching projects covering small to medium garden beds. Most routine jobs fall within this range, with fewer projects reaching the higher end for additional materials or larger areas.

Landscape Bed Refresh - Re-mulching existing beds typically costs around $600-$1,200 depending on the size and type of mulch used. Larger or more complex beds can push costs toward $1,500 or more, though these are less common.

Full Mulch Installation - Installing mulch over extensive landscaping or multiple beds often ranges from $1,200 to $3,000. Many projects are in the middle of this range, while very large or detailed installations may exceed $3,500.

Complete Mulch Replacement - For complete removal and replacement of existing mulch, costs usually start at $2,000 and can go beyond $5,000 for large, intricate landscapes. Such high-end projects are less frequent but represent the upper tier of typical costs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of landscape mulching? Landscape mulching helps improve the appearance of gardens, suppress weeds, conserve soil moisture, and protect plant roots from temperature fluctuations.

What types of mulch are commonly used for landscaping? Common mulch options include wood chips, bark, shredded leaves, straw, and rubber mulch, each offering different aesthetic and functional benefits.

How do local contractors typically prepare for mulching projects? Contractors usually assess the landscape, clear existing debris, define mulching areas, and prepare the soil surface to ensure proper installation and longevity of the mulch.

Can mulching be done around different types of plants and trees? Yes, mulching is suitable for a variety of plants, trees, and flower beds, helping to maintain soil health and reduce maintenance needs.

What should be considered when choosing mulch for a landscape? Consider factors such as mulch type, color, durability, and how well it complements the landscape design and local climate conditions.
